Devin Smith tears ACL, per Bowles

Jets WR Devin Smith tore his ACL Sunday against the Titans, Coach Todd Bowles confirms.

“It’s unfortunate that this happened,” said Bowles on a conference call to reporters. “He was coming around; he was really going to help us.”

The first year receiver out of Ohio State has had a rough season plagued by both injuries and drops, but did seem to be showing progress. Smith caught his first touchdown pass two weeks ago against the Dolphins, which had Offensive Coordinator Chan Gailey hoping it would serve as a catalyst for the remainder of the season.

Smith will have to wait until next year to continue that progress on the field.
